Output 58598641ecf5f4b12821efcd72b99e011d02e7bf105c9b465a03b4df6a778a7c:1

value
292215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41e96ae759c8c82ae075929f17d1f23142f4f42e OP_EQUALVERIFY OP_CHECKSIG
address
171WYcF69xZ31KfyHbEgXp7a4N6JD8LLj9
transaction
58598641ecf5f4b12821efcd72b99e011d02e7bf105c9b465a03b4df6a778a7c